Crispy Chicken Taquitos

Get ready to elevate your snack game with these irresistibly **Crispy Chicken Taquitos**, a crowd-pleasing recipe that combines bold flavors with a delightful crunch! Packed with a creamy, cheesy filling made from tender shredded rotisserie chicken, cream cheese, Monterey Jack, and cheddar, these taquitos are seasoned to perfection with garlic, cumin, and salsa for a zesty kick. Wrapped in warm, pliable corn tortillas and fried until golden brown, each bite delivers a satisfying crispiness that’s perfect for game days, weeknight dinners, or parties. Finish them off in the oven for an extra-melty interior, and serve with your favorite toppings like guacamole, sour cream, or more salsa for the ultimate Mexican-inspired treat. Quick to prepare in just 40 minutes, this recipe will quickly become a go-to for anyone craving the perfect balance of savory, cheesy, and crunchy goodness!

Prep Time:20 mins
Cook Time:20 mins
Total Time:40 mins
Servings: 4

Ingredients

  • 2 cups Rotisserie chicken, shredded
  • 4 oz Cream cheese, softened
  • 1 cup Monterey Jack cheese, shredded
  • 1 cup Cheddar cheese, shredded
  • 1 cup Salsa
  • 1 tsp Garlic powder
  • 1 tsp Onion powder
  • 1 tsp Cumin
  • 0.5 tsp Salt
  • 0.5 tsp Black pepper
  • 12 pieces Corn tortillas
  • 0.5 cup Vegetable oil

Directions

Step 1

Preheat your oven to 425°F (220°C).

Step 2

In a large mixing bowl, combine the shredded rotisserie chicken, softened cream cheese, Monterey Jack cheese, Cheddar cheese, salsa, garlic powder, onion powder, cumin, salt, and black pepper. Mix well until all ingredients are evenly incorporated.

Step 3

Warm the corn tortillas in a microwave or skillet to make them pliable and prevent cracking when rolling.

Step 4

Place about 2 tablespoons of the chicken mixture onto the center of each tortilla and roll it tightly.

Step 5

Secure each rolled tortilla with a toothpick to keep it closed during cooking.

Step 6

In a large skillet, heat the vegetable oil over medium-high heat.

Step 7

Once the oil is hot, place the rolled taquitos seam-side down in the skillet. Fry them in batches, being careful not to overcrowd the skillet.

Step 8

Cook the taquitos for about 3-4 minutes on each side, or until they are golden brown and crispy.

Step 9

Once cooked, transfer the taquitos to a baking sheet lined with paper towels to drain any excess oil.

Step 10

Remove the toothpicks and place the drained taquitos on a baking sheet. Bake in the preheated oven for an additional 5-7 minutes to ensure the filling is hot and the cheese is melted.

Step 11

Serve the taquitos hot with your choice of toppings like guacamole, sour cream, or extra salsa.
